Position Summary 

Maintain production and quality of  equipment in the warehouse.

Duties:

 Duties and Responsibilities:   

  1. ACT, REGULATIONS AND CODES:

The candidate is expected to be able to locate information relating to the staffing, operation, maintenance, inspection, and testing of the equipment:

a. Technical Standards & Safety as Defined by Equipment Manufacturer

b. Operating Guidelines as Defined by Equipment Manufacturer

c. Preventive Maintenance Procedures

d. Proper Repair Procedures as Defined by Equipment Manufacturer

 

2. SAFETY:

The candidate is expected to be able to fully explain the dangers associated with the operation of production equipment. Demonstrate the proper use of Lock Out Tag Out on Production Equipment.  Demonstrate the proper use of Hot Work Permit.

 

3. OPERATION:

The candidate is expected to be able to answer examination questions as they relate to the operation, maintenance and the management of the production equipment. Perform tasks associated with qualifications of C mechanics.

The candidate is expected to properly perform preventive maintenance on production equipment by following set practices by manufacturer and employer guidelines.

The candidate is expected to properly perform service on production equipment by following set practices by manufacturer and employer guidelines.

 

4. SKILL SETS:

The candidate is expected to be able to execute the following skills:

a. Soldering of copper pipe

b. Proper use of an electrical meter for troubleshooting, both in A/C and D/C

c. Read Blueprints and schematics

d. Troubleshoot pneumatic components

e. Basic mechanical skills

 

5. LAYOUT:

The candidate is expected to be able to layout electrical for electrical load based on

mechanical installations of equipment.

The candidate is expected to be able to layout pneumatic supply lines based on load for equipment.

Qualifications:

  1. HS Diploma or equivalent.
  2. Industry or manufacturer's technician certifications preferred.
  3. Must be at least 18 years of age to work in warehouse.
  4. A minimum of  three years of  warehouse handling equipment or equivalent experience.
  5. Must demonstrate proficient PC skills.
  6. Ability to operate a variety of Powered Industrial Equipment.
  7. Obtain Powered Industrial Certification for lift trucks, pallet jacks and man lifts preferred, but not necessary.
  8. Ability to occasionally lift and carry up to 75 pounds.
  9. Must have own transportation.
  10. Must be able to work a flexible schedule to include holidays and weekends.
  11. Must be able to, with reasonable accommodations, lift and carry up to 75 pounds, work in temperatures, which range from 28-90 degrees, work in a wet, damp and dusty environment, and ability to read/understand warehouse documents.
